WebApr 18, 2024 · There are two types of drills you can perform to improve court movement: A - Change of Direction (COD) - is used to describe a pre-planned drill or movement, whereby athletes change movement … WebSep 9, 2024 · This study aimed to analyze the effect of speed, agility and quickness training program to increase in speed, agility and acceleration. This study was conducted at 26 soccer players and divided into 2 groups with 13 players each group. Group 1 was given SAQ training program, and Group 2 conventional training program for 8 weeks. terry hibbitt footballer

If you have access to an agility ladder (also known as a speed ladder), you can perform a multitude of agility exercises to improve the precision of your footwork, as well as your ability to change direction. The following are just a few of the top agility ladder exercises you can perform in your workout routine.
